Default 91 crx doing b16 swap

well what cluth cable do we use.. this is a JDM b16 the older one with the white plugs. the 91 crx clutch cable is like 1 inch to short to use with the bracket that came on the tranny.

Default Re: 91 crx doing b16 swap (BoostedH23a1)

My stock cable works fine.... the problem at first was we weren't pulling the clutch arm up far enough, thought we had it all the way, but actually we werent even engaging the clutch, it pulled up another 3 inches...... Make sure thats not the case.
